Don't listen to bias.
I just got my 360 on Oct. 30th because I knew it was the one I wanted.
However, the 360 has major problems. The first being that it overheats a LOT. Make sure you get the one with a falcon chip in it. Secondly, if you have a game and the Xbox is tipped over or moved, your cd is scratched and dead. Lastly, the wireless adapter is 100 bucks. Wow.
Why should you get the 360? The most definite answer is Live. Compared to PS3 or Wii, 360 wins here. And this is a key part about why I bought it. Live lets you play around the world and a mic is thrown in as well.
Another reason to get a 360 is for mature singleplayer games. You can see this in games like Condemned, Bioshock and soon to be Mass Effect.
You have to look at gaming in 3 perspectives:
The singleplayer, the offline multiplayer and online multiplayer.
Singleplayer is again about mature storylines, a plus for me. Online multiplayer is good here to to with Xbox Live. 50 bucks a month is not bad at all. The weakest part is definitely the offline multiplayer. The problem here is that you tend to have new people over who have never played the Xbox and they will suck when they vs. you. That's where the Wii is clearly better.
So again, if you want a strong offline multiplayer, and you want your singleplayer games to be about strong stories, then I suggest Xbox. Make sure you take care of it however. Also, get the one with 2 free games.
Again, I'll say it's what you are looking for.
If you spend all your time online, then X360 with Live is the best option.
If you want singleplayer games with mature plots, X360 is the choice.
If you simply play games with your friends offline, I say go with the Wii.
If you like Nintendo's singleplayer games better, again go to Wii.
If you really want RPGs and a free, yet somewhat limiting online mode, you might want to get a PS3.
